Grid: classic round hole grid
The curved lenses have a continuous, coarser round grid. This allows a particularly large amount of light to enter the eye. This type of grid is suitable for almost everyone and is also often used as a precautionary measure.

The origins according to William Bates
William Bates, the pioneer of modern eye training, was able to show through numerous experiments that vision can be trained. He recognised that it is not the lens, but the six external eye muscles that are responsible for focusing.
In 1920, he published his findings in the work Perfect Sight Without Glasses. This formed the basis for the Bates Method, which involves simple exercises to improve vision. Later, Janet Goodrich conducted the first studies on the effect of pinhole glasses and further developed the method.
